Analysis
Russian Federation recorded 6.6% for food exports in 2021.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 20.8% on the previous year and up 202.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, food exports in Russian Federation peaked at 8.3% in 2020 and was at its lowest, 1.0%, in 1999.
Russian Federation ranks 149th of 196 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Food comprises the commodities in SITC (Rev. 3) sections 0 (food and live animals), 1 (beverages and tobacco), and 4 (animal and vegetable oils and fats) and division 22 (oil seeds, oil nuts, and oil kernels). This indicator is expressed as a percentage of merchandise exports which is comprised of goods whose economic ownership is changed between a resident and a non-resident and that are not included in the following specific categories: goods under merchanting, non-monetary gold, and parts of travel, construction, and government goods and services n.i.e.
